I suggest to get acquainted with the most simple and fast for the establishment of a manicure - a classic manicure.

It is done most simply and quickly, at the same time the nails are well-groomed appearance. Before you start creating a classic manicure you need to get your nails are completely dry. It should be cut with scissors nails to the desired length. Then modify them using a nail file. When using nail files, move them in one direction, as they will be less flaky.

If you want to remove the cuticle.

For the most appropriate removal, apply cuticle softener. Wait a few minutes until it is absorbed. Take warm water and soap, it will soften the skin. Then take a spear and blade, through their separate cuticles. Cut with scissors (preferably curved) cuticle.

If you have any burrs that they would not need to nebylo than trying to pull and tear, it is necessary to remove them to steam your hands in warm water, it is desirable to also add one or two teaspoons of glycerin. After a good steaming wipe your fingers and nails towel. Using nail clippers to remove burrs.
